12/1 Fingerontheswitch weighted to go well at Haydock

Fingerontheswitch looks weighted to go well in the 4.25 at Haydock today and makes plenty of each-way appeal at 12/1.

Neil Mulholland’s gelding landed his last hurdles success at Doncaster back in February 2016 when scoring by 3 lengths off a rating of 123.

He backed that up with a solid second in this contest off 137 and has twice finished runner-up this season off 127.

Fingerontheswitch is now able to race off 120, a career low over the smaller obstacles and just 1lb higher than when last sucessful in a handicap cahse at Wetherby 13 months ago.

It gives him every chance from a handicapping persoective and this is easier than when he was far from disgraced over course and distance when sixth of 16 to Sam Spinner off 10lb higher.

He also didn’t shape too badly last time out when fiurth at Doncaster and with Harry Reed taking off another 5lb with his claim looks too well-treated to ignore on the pick of his form.
